Dear Ms. Bonace: In your letter dated April 2, 1993,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The furniture item is a 4-tier corner stand, Blair Model No. 1211. This corner stand has four shelves, each a different size and is constructed of particle board with a cherry finish veneer. The spindles are comprised of solid hardwood. The stand is 40 inches in height and 13-1/4 inches deep. It will be imported unassembled with all hardware and assembly instructions included. The corner stand is designed to be placed on the floor or ground. The sample you submitted will be returned under separate cover. The applicable subheading for the 4-tier wooden corner stand will be 9403.60.8080,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States Annotated, HTSUSA, which provides for other wooden furniture: Other. The rate of duty will be 2.5 percent ad valorem.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Section 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of this ruling letter should be attached to the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
